采用序列脉冲红宝石激光器作为光源、国产640型纹影仪作为图像及流场显示光学系统、等待型转镜高速摄影机为记录单元的脉冲激光高速纹影摄影系统,我们已经相继研制了两种型号。Ⅰ型系统用于终点弹道的穿甲过程和中间弹道的出膛过程的记录,已经取得较好的结果。Ⅱ型系统用于研究高能炸药起爆机理,拍得了弹丸撞靶前的飞行姿态及撞靶后的压缩变形直至点火爆炸过程的分幅照片,为研究工作提供了依据。本文还论述了该系统的发展。
With the high speed colliding's proceses, the intense flash phenomena will occur. It is not easy to obtain the clear image with the conventional highspeed photographic method. The powerful luminescent brightness and good monochromatism of laser are used for the sequential pulsed laser light source in high speed schlieren photographic system. The interference filter, added in front of camera lens, can be used for removing the flash disturbance. A seriers of the shadow and schlieren pictures can be recorded.Our Department have designed and trial-manufactured the Q-switched ruby laser with sequential pulses of Model XMJ-2 and the access type rotating mirror scanning high-speed camera of Model MJGS-10. They and a schlieren apperatus of Model 640 are made Pulse Laser High-speed Schlieren Photographic System. The better results have been obtained.
